P0370 — Timing Reference High Resolution Signal « A »
OBD-II trouble code P0370 indicates an issue with the vehicle’s timing reference signals, specifically the high-resolution signal associated with engine timing management. This code suggests that the Engine Control Unit (ECU) is detecting irregularities or inconsistencies in the timing reference signal used to control engine timing. It’s important to note that labels for this code may vary among different vehicle manufacturers, but the underlying issue remains similar.
- System affected: Engine Timing / Crankshaft / Camshaft sensors
- Severity: Moderate — may affect engine performance if unresolved
- Main symptoms: Rough idling, hesitation, check engine light
- Driveability: Limited — vehicle may operate normally initially but risks worsening performance
Manufacturer variations for trouble code P0370
Different vehicle manufacturers may assign varying labels or codes for issues related to the timing reference signal. While OBD-II standard codes are generally consistent, manufacturers sometimes incorporate specific identifiers in their diagnostic systems. In the case of P0370, some OEMs might refer to similar issues with alternative labels or codes that point to timing reference problems.
- Ford: P0345 or similar codes — related to camshaft or crankshaft positioning signals
- Toyota: C1400 series — related to timing control systems
- Honda: P0335 / P0341 — often linked to crank/cam position sensors, but may include timing signal issues
- Volkswagen / Audi: Codes referring to control module or sensor signal irregularities, e.g., P0016 / P0017
What does trouble code P0370 mean?
The P0370 trouble code indicates that the Engine Control Module (ECM) has detected a problem with the Timing Reference High Resolution Signal, often called the « A » signal. This signal is essential because it provides precise information about the crankshaft’s position, which is crucial for synchronising fuel injection and ignition timing. If this signal is inconsistent, missing, or erratic, the engine control system cannot accurately manage timing, leading to potential drivability issues.
The ECU constantly monitors multiple sensors and signals to ensure accurate engine timing. The timing reference high-resolution signal, generated by sensors such as the crankshaft position sensor (or similar), must be stable and reliable. When the ECU detects irregularities—such as irregular voltage, signal interruption, or inconsistent pulse patterns—it flags this as a code. Typically, this issue appears in specific contexts, such as during engine start-up, deceleration, or when the engine is under load.
Severity and risks of trouble code P0370
The P0370 code is considered to have a moderate severity. If left unaddressed, it can lead to a range of drivability issues including poor engine performance, rough idling, or feel of hesitation. More critically, if the timing reference signal is persistently compromised, it could affect engine timing accuracy, which in turn can cause long-term damage to engine components or reduce fuel efficiency.
In some cases, this code can cause the engine to run in a default or “limp” mode, severely limiting performance to protect internal components. However, in many instances, the vehicle may still be drivable but with compromised engine response. Therefore, Yes — the vehicle can be driven, but it is advisable to investigate and resolve the underlying issue quickly to avoid further damage or unexpected breakdowns.
Symptoms of trouble code P0370
The presence of a P0370 code often coincides with various drivability symptoms, although some vehicles may display minimal issues initially. Common symptoms include:
- Engine warning light (check engine light) illuminated on the dashboard
- Unusual engine idling or rough operation
- Engine hesitation or loss of power during acceleration
- Difficulty starting the engine
- Irregular engine deceleration or stalling in some conditions
- Erratic or inconsistent engine timing behaviour detectable through live data readings
Most likely causes of trouble code P0370
Understanding the causes of P0370 helps target inspections and repairs precisely. Here are the most common causes ranked from most to least likely:
- Faulty or failing crankshaft position sensor: The sensor that detects crankshaft position might be damaged, dirty, or disconnected, resulting in an irregular high-resolution timing signal.
- Wiring or connector issues: Damaged, corroded, or loose wiring and connectors between the sensor and the ECU can disrupt the signal transmission.
- Problems with the timing belt/chain or related components: If the timing belt or chain is worn, stretched, or misaligned, the crankshaft’s position signal may become inconsistent.
- Timing sensor calibration or installation error: Recently replaced sensors or timing components that are incorrectly installed or misaligned can cause the ECU to detect an abnormal signal.
- ECU or control module malfunction: Although less common, a fault within the ECU itself can lead to incorrect signal interpretation or communication issues.
How to diagnose trouble code P0370
Diagnosing P0370 accurately involves systematic inspection and testing. Here are generic diagnostic steps suitable for most vehicles:
- Visual inspection: Check the wiring harness, connectors, and sensor for obvious damage, corrosion, or loose connections.
- Verify sensor operation: Use a scan tool with live data capability to monitor the crankshaft position sensor signal during engine operation.
- Test the wiring continuity: Perform electrical continuity tests on sensor wiring to ensure there are no breaks or shorts.
- Check the sensor’s physical condition: Remove the sensor if accessible and inspect for dirt, damage, or misalignment, then replace if necessary.
- Inspect timing components: Confirm proper timing belt or chain alignment, especially following recent repairs or replacements.
- Test the sensor voltage output: Use a multimeter to measure the sensor’s voltage signals to determine if they are within manufacturer specifications.
- Scan for additional DTCs: Search for related codes such as P0335 (Crankshaft Sensor) or P0340 (Camshaft Signal) for more context.
Possible repairs for trouble code P0370
Resolving P0370 often involves addressing the root cause identified during diagnosis. The following repairs are common; some are basic, while others may require professional skills:
- Replace faulty crankshaft position sensor: Quite often, sensor replacement restores proper signal transmission. This is a straightforward repair for DIY enthusiasts or technicians.
- Repair or replace damaged wiring or connectors: Fixing wiring issues can involve cleaning, soldering, or replacing damaged wiring harness segments. Usually a professional task.
- Realign or replace timing belt/chain: If timing components are misaligned or worn, a timing belt/chain replacement or realignment is required. This typically needs professional expertise due to complexity and precision.
- Recalibrate or reprogram ECU: If ECU malfunction is suspected, updating or reprogramming may be necessary, which typically requires manufacturer-specific tools and expertise.
- Address underlying mechanical issues: For example, replacing worn timing components or fixing misalignments to ensure reliable sensor signals.
Vehicles commonly associated with trouble code P0370 in Europe
While P0370 is a generic code, certain vehicle brands and engine families are more frequently associated with timing reference issues. Typical associations include:
Volkswagen Group (Volkswagen, Audi, SEAT, Skoda): Vehicles with petrol or diesel engines, especially those with direct injection and timing sensors.
Ford: Certain petrol engines relying on crankshaft sensors for timing reference.
Toyota / Lexus: Engine models with variable valve timing systems that depend on sensitive timing signals.
Honda: Various petrol engines with crankshaft and camshaft sensors integral to engine timing control.
Frequent mistakes with trouble code P0370
Diagnosing and repairing P0370 can sometimes go awry due to common errors. Being aware of these pitfalls ensures a more effective repair process:
- Neglecting the wiring and connector inspections: Overlooking wiring issues often leads to misdiagnosis.
- Replacing components without proper testing: Replacing sensors or timing components blindly can result in unnecessary expenses.
- Ignoring related codes: Failure to investigate other diagnostic trouble codes may obscure the root cause.
- Assuming ECU malfunction prematurely: Electronic control modules are rarely at fault unless proven during testing.
- Not following manufacturer repair procedures: For precise timing or sensor replacement, improper procedures can cause recurring issues.
FAQ — trouble code P0370
Can this code disappear on its own?
While some intermittent issues may resolve temporarily, P0370 typically indicates a persistent problem that requires repair. Relying on it to disappear without addressing the root cause is not advisable.
Can I keep driving?
Yes, but with caution. Driving with this code may cause engine performance issues, and long-term driving without repair could risk further damage. It’s best to schedule a diagnostic and repair promptly.
Why does the code return after clearing?
If the underlying fault remains, clearing the code simply removes the warning temporarily. If the cause is not fixed, the system will detect the issue again and return the code. Addressing the root cause is essential for a permanent fix.
